For some really large cats, even the largest litter boxes may not be big enough. A good rule of thumb is that the box should be at least 1.5 times the length of the cat from the nose to the base of the tail. You want your cat to be able to comfortably turn around in the box. Choosing the wrong litter box can have dire consequences for cats: litter box avoidance is one of the main reasons why many cats are surrendered to shelters. Unfortunately, cat guardians often select a litter box for all the wrong reasons – or at least for the wrong reasons from the cat’s perspective.
